Why Standard Home Insurance Often Fails for Luxury Watches
Many Spanish home insurance policies technically include watches under contents insurance, but usually with important restrictions.
Common limitations include:
- Low single-item limits
- Reduced compensation structures
- Limited theft protection outside the home
- Exclusions for accidental loss
- Restrictions for portable valuables
- Security requirements
- Limited worldwide protection
In practice, many Rolex and luxury watches exceed ordinary contents insurance limits entirely.

Watch Valuations & Proof of Ownership
Specialist luxury watch insurance policies commonly require supporting documentation.
Insurers may request:
- Purchase invoice
- Professional valuation
- Serial number
- Watch photographs
- Box and papers
- Security details
Valuations are especially important because many luxury watches appreciate significantly over time.
Using outdated valuations may create underinsurance problems during claims.
This is particularly relevant for:
- Vintage Rolex watches
- Collectible references
- Limited editions
- Watches purchased several years ago
- High-value watch collections
Keeping valuations updated helps ensure the insured value reflects real replacement cost and current market conditions.
Luxury Watch Insurance Cost in Spain
The cost of luxury watch insurance in Spain depends on:
- Watch value
- Worldwide exposure
- Claims history
- Travel frequency
- Security protections
- Number of watches insured
- Valuation structure
Indicative annual premium ranges:
| Watch Value | Approximate Annual Cost |
|---|---|
| €5,000 | €80–€180 |
| €10,000 | €150–€350 |
| €25,000+ | Case-based |
Worldwide protection and collectible watches generally increase premiums.

Common Luxury Watch Insurance Mistakes
The most common issues include:
- Assuming home insurance fully covers luxury watches
- Forgetting worldwide protection
- Using outdated valuations
- Not declaring watches specifically
- Choosing policies based only on price
- Ignoring accidental loss exclusions
Many rejected luxury watch insurance claims occur because the watch was never individually declared or properly valued within the policy structure.

1.Is a Rolex covered under home insurance in Spain?
Usually only partially. Many Spanish home insurance policies apply low single-item limits, portable valuables restrictions and reduced compensation structures that may leave Rolex and other luxury watches significantly underinsured.

9.Why are luxury watch insurance claims sometimes rejected?
Common reasons include undeclared watches, outdated valuations, accidental loss exclusions, portable valuables restrictions or failure to comply with security requirements.
